Formed from undergird + -er, literally "something that braces from beneath." The historical nautical noun renders Greek hypozoma (plural hypozomata), "an undergirding," from hypozonnymi ("to gird underneath"). Such heavy ropes or cables reinforced a trireme's long hull. Jowett's Republic uses both closed and hyphenated plural spellings.
